excel根据列类型分类
题记:主要循环获取文件夹下的所有excel并存储,并截取表格名称新建作为数据存储的文件夹。
import os
import pandas as pd
t_addr = r''#excel存储的文件夹
s_addr = r'' + '\\'#分解后要存储的目标文件
files = []
for dirpath,dirnames,filenames in os.walk(t_addr):for file in filenames:if file.endswith('.xlsx') or file.endswith('.xls'):files.append(dirpath+'\\'+file)
for file in files:print(file)dp = file[:file.index(".xls")]str1 = dp.split("\\")dp1 = str1[str1.__len__()-1]dirPath2 = s_addr + dp1 + '\\'print(dirPath2)os.mkdir(dirPath2)orgName = pd.read_excel(file,sheet_name='生成数据')org_list = list(orgName['WEBSITE COUNTRY'].drop_duplicates())print(org_list)print('总数量:'+str(org_list.__len__()))for i in org_list:writer = pd.ExcelWriter(dirPath2 + str(i)+'.xlsx')tempdata = orgName[orgName['WEBSITE COUNTRY'] == i]tempdata.to_excel(writer, index=False)writer.save()writer.close()
excel根据列类型分类相关推荐
- oracle报错分类,localdateTime与oracle映射报错无效列类型
当前使用版本(必须填写清楚,否则不予处理) com.baomidou mybatis-plus-boot-starter 3.1.2版本 但是1.0.5版本没有问题,可以正常映射使用 该问题是怎么引起 ...
- java获取xlsx某列数据_Java读取Excel指定列的数据详细教程和注意事项
本文使用jxl.jar工具类库实现读取Excel中指定列的数据. jxl.jar是通过java操作excel表格的工具类库,是由java语言开发而成的.这套API是纯Java的,并不依赖Windows ...
- python对excel表统计视频教程_Python实现对excel文件列表值进行统计的方法
本文实例讲述了Python实现对excel文件列表值进行统计的方法.分享给大家供大家参考.具体如下: #!/usr/bin/env python #coding=gbk #此PY用来统计一个execl ...
- 用python编excel统计表_Python实现对excel文件列表值进行统计的方法
本文实例讲述了Python实现对excel文件列表值进行统计的方法.分享给大家供大家参考.具体如下: #!/usr/bin/env python #coding=gbk #此PY用来统计一个execl ...
- sohu_news搜狐新闻类型分类
sohu_news搜狐新闻类型分类 数据获取 数据是从搜狐新闻开放的新闻xml数据,经过一系列的处理之后,生成的一个excel文件 该xml文件的处理有单独的处理过程,就是用pandas处理,该过程在 ...
- 用JavaScript读取excel并按列转换为数组
首先说一下,ie浏览器有个ActiveXObject的属性,可以很方便的操作excel,网上也有很大教程,就不再赘述了,自行百度. 如果是非ie浏览器的,则需要用到html5的FileReader属性 ...
- excel多列多行堆叠成多列一行_「Excel技巧」Excel快速实现将一行转为多行多列的四种方法...
今天来说说在Excel中,将表格里的一列转换为多行多列的几种方法. 例如,以下表格,是一个行业分类表,都放在同一列中.现我们准备把它转为多列. 表格里数据除掉标题行行,总共有60列数据,干脆我们就给它 ...
- 技巧:给excel某列数据加双引号和逗号,用于sql中in()查询
配套视频笔记:https://www.bilibili.com/video/BV1iG4y1U7r2 背景 就是需求给过来一个excel,我们要用其中的某一列作为条件去查询数据库,删数据或者改数据. ...
- 实用算法题:excel表列序号与十进制数字的互相转化算法讲解!
日常生活中excel的使用大家都不陌生,可能几列的表格我们还能脑海中参照A-Z来区分对应的数字应该是几.但有的表格列过多,或者鼠标一甩到了很后面的位置,好几个字母拼起来,一时间很难反映过来对应的数字是 ...
最新文章
- NHibernate 基本配置 (第一篇)
- 支付宝app支付对接2(文档和对接注意问题)
- boost::type_index模块type_index`(和 `type_info`)能够存储确切的类型,无需剥离 const、volatile 和引用
- boost::coroutine模块实现layout的测试程序
- Git gitignore文件讲解
- 当心XML文件中的非法字符
- visual studio code(vscode)的使用(快捷键)
- 《Flutter 从0到1构建大前端应用》读后感—第6章【使用网络技术与异步编程】
- 【转】响应式布局和自适应布局详解
- MAC苹果电脑装单win10系统
- TTL反相器 电路分析
- JAVA生成热点图,JAVA 后端生成热力图图片返回
- Docker教程(一)入门教程
- laravel 请求出现 post The page has expired due to inactivity.
- [联想官方工具]关闭Win10自动更新工具 最新版 2.6.21.816
- Android 仿淘宝京东商品详情页阻力翻页效果
- 树莓派利用3.5mm接口接扬声器播放语音提示
- CLRS 3.1渐进记号
- 设计与算法 | Google Photos Web UI
- 和融跃一起零基础学习FRM
热门文章
- Andoird实现类似iphone AssistiveTouch的控件的demo
- 考了华为认证,如何找工作?能进哪些公司?有没有前景?
- 别让昨天在你伤口狂妄的撒盐
- 按键扫描,看看牛人如何5个I/O口,设置25个按键的
- Nature Neuroscience:焦虑为何导致“社恐”?李晓明团队揭示相关脑机制
- 卜若代码笔记系列的bug集合-3999
- 跨境电商“9710”“9810”是什么?
- InterruptException处理方法
- 《红楼梦》园林场景叙事
- java多态的应用场景_Java多态总结